
MoEngage, has announce the acquisition of agentic AI solution, Aampe, to “complete its vision” of a scaleable and unified Agentic Customer Engagement Platform.
Marking MoEngage’s first acquisition, the move will help marketers, ecommerce and growth teams leverage autonomous agents to drive true 1-2-1 personalisation and engagement at individual customer-level.
As AI adoption grows, almost two thirds of UK shoppers want to use agentic AI in their buying journeys, according to new research released this week from Commerce and PayPal.
However, separate research from Quickfire Digital points to personalisation holding AI-purchasing experiences back; its poll suggests nearly half (45%) of shoppers are frustrated by current AI-led shopping experiences, with generic recommendations and engagement key friction points.
Using its agentic infrastructure, Aampe’s solution learns from processing over 200 billion decisions a week, allowing marketers to define content, goals and guardrails, while AI agents handle the decisions, message composition and iterative messaging for each shopper.
Aampe’s capabilities will integrate with MoEngage’s Merlin AI agents, which are already being used by brands including Loblaws and Soundcloud, and help digital teams build content, launch campaigns, design customer journeys and surface insights with greater efficiency.
This, MoEngage said, would deliver AI “scale, without sacrificing human relevance.”
